FURULUND SENTER AS is registered as a limited company in Lillehammer, Innlandet with organisation number 967140031. The business is classified under rental and operating of own or leased real estate (NACE 68.200). The company was incorporated in 1993. Registered share capital is NOK 1.0m, divided into 5500 shares. The company's stated purpose is: “Eie og forestå drift av forretningseiendommer, samt tilknyttet næringsvirksomhet og annen virksomhet.”. The most recent filed accounts, for the 2024 financial year, show NOK 5.5m in revenue and NOK 2.9m in operating profit.
